function nuevoAjax(){
	  var xmlhttp=false;
	  try { xmlhttp = new ActiveXObject("Msxml2.XMLHTTP"); } catch (e) { try { xmlhttp = new ActiveXObject("Microsoft.XMLHTTP");  } catch (E) { xmlhttp = false; } }
	  if (!xmlhttp && typeof XMLHttpRequest!='undefined') {  xmlhttp = new XMLHttpRequest(); } 
	  return xmlhttp; 
}


function enviarMail(){

			c = document.getElementById('resultado_mensaje');
			dest="biotopica@gmail.com";
			
			nombrecomercial    = document.registrobiotpicalineaprofesional.nombrecomercial.value;
			cif                = document.registrobiotpicalineaprofesional.cif.value;
			nucleozoologico    = document.registrobiotpicalineaprofesional.nucleozoologico.value;
			nombre             = document.registrobiotpicalineaprofesional.nombre.value;
			apellidos          = document.registrobiotpicalineaprofesional.apellidos.value;
			direccion          = document.registrobiotpicalineaprofesional.direccion.value;
			localidad          = document.registrobiotpicalineaprofesional.localidad.value;	
			poblacion          = document.registrobiotpicalineaprofesional.poblacion.value;
			codigopostal       = document.registrobiotpicalineaprofesional.codigopostal.value;	
			pais               = document.registrobiotpicalineaprofesional.pais.value;	
			email              = document.registrobiotpicalineaprofesional.email.value;	
			web                = document.registrobiotpicalineaprofesional.web.value;	
			telefono           = document.registrobiotpicalineaprofesional.telefono.value;	
			telefonofax        = document.registrobiotpicalineaprofesional.telefonofax.value;
			telefonomovil      = document.registrobiotpicalineaprofesional.telefonomovil.value;	
			


			if (nombrecomercial < 24) {
       		    alert("Falta tu nombre comercial.");
				document.registrobiotpicalineaprofesional.nombrecomercial.focus();
				return (false);
			}


			if (cif < 9) {
       		    alert("Falta tu CIF.");
				document.registrobiotpicalineaprofesional.cif.focus();
				return (false);
			}





			if ((document.registrobiotpicalineaprofesional.email.value.indexOf ('@', 0) == -1)||(document.registrobiotpicalineaprofesional.email.value.length < 5)) {
				alert("Escribe una dirección de correo válida en el campo Email para que nos podamos poner en contacto con tu empresa.");
				return (false);
			}




			ajax=nuevoAjax();
			c.innerHTML = '<p style="text-align:center;"><img src="esperando.gif"/></p>'; 
			ajax.open("POST", "biotopicaRegistroEmpresa.php",true);
			ajax.onreadystatechange=function() {
				if (ajax.readyState==4) { c.innerHTML = ajax.responseText }
				borrarCampos()
			}
			
			ajax.setRequestHeader("Content-Type","application/x-www-form-urlencoded");
			ajax.send("destinatario="+dest+"&nombrecomercial="+nombrecomercial
					  					  +"&cif="+cif
										  +"&nucleozoologico="+nucleozoologico
										  +"&nombre="+nombre
										  +"&apellidos="+apellidos
										  +"&direccion="+direccion
										  +"&localidad="+localidad
										  +"&poblacion="+poblacion
										  +"&codigopostal="+codigopostal
										  +"&pais="+pais
										  +"&email="+email
										  +"&web="+web
										  +"&telefono="+telefono
										  +"&telefonofax="+telefonofax
										  +"&telefonomovil="+telefonomovil )
}

function borrarCampos(){
	document.registrobiotpicalineaprofesional.nombrecomercial.value="";
	document.registrobiotpicalineaprofesional.nombrecomercial.focus();
	
	
}